Ideal Growing Conditions – White Elf Oyster
Substrate: Supplemented hardwood sawdust, wood chips
Colonisation Temperature: 22°C – 26°C
Fruiting Temperature: 16°C – 20°C
Humidity: 85–95%
CO₂ concentration: Low (requires good fresh air exchange for proper development)
White Elf Oyster prefers well-prepared hardwood substrates and benefits from stable conditions and sufficient airflow.
About White Elf Oyster
White Elf Oyster (Pleurotus nebrodensis) is a rare gourmet mushroom known for its thick, dense structure and high culinary value. Unlike typical oyster mushrooms, it produces more compact, individual fruiting bodies with a firm, meaty texture.

What Is Liquid Culture
Liquid Culture (LC) is live mushroom mycelium suspended in a nutrient-rich liquid medium. It allows for faster colonisation and more consistent results compared to spores.
